Social Networking Business Success Story. Got Any of Your Own?

Social networking as we all know has hit the big time. Personally, we are fanatics of Facebook, Linked-In, and Twitter. I know there’s millions of others, but these 3 take up quite of bit of attention as it is I can’t imagine adding another to the mix. The point of this post is we began on the “Big 3” (my apologies to the 2008/09 Celtics for lifting that monikor) to network on behalf of our business, Pole to Pole Consulting (www.poletopoleconsulting.com). Needless to say the experience to date has been awesome. So much so, that we recently collaborated and closed a nice-sized deal with a contact found off Twitter!!!

If you had asked me ahead of time which of the 3 would yield the most business potential, Twitter would be last. My Linked-In connections have provided awesome ideas and we have a couple things in the works, but believe it or not Twitter has really surprised me. Facebook is nice, but without paying for advertising I’m not sure it has enough upside to reach more unknown people than Twitter.
